I can remember if someone has asked this question already...but i need a fascia for my stereo...went to my local car stereo retailer today...they had an autoleads one in black but when checking the clolour match inside the car it looked more blue/grey...Has anyone managed to purchase a black one that matches PERFECT! I would only be happy to buy on eBay if i cant find a local retailer in Leicester. Thanks and please help

Ok further on...went to another stereo outlet today...found one made by connects2...pure black...but it comes in bits that you have to assemble...didnt look sturdy...so decision time:

Autoleads...blueish/grey...solid 1 piece £14.99

OR

Connects2...pure black...bits to assemble £19.99

Anyone with comments/experiences???
